Magic/Bobcats preview

The Magic (15-9, 7-5 road) will try to right the ship against struggling CHA (5-16, 3-8 home), who has the second worst record in the NBA, and has lost 4 games in a row. CHA is coming off a 104-101 loss at CLE WED night. Adam Morrison led CHA with 16 pts.

CHA is led by C Emeka Okafor, averaging 15.7 ppg, 10.3 rebs, 2.9 blocks. Rookie Morrison is averaging 13.3 ppg, but is shooting only 36.8%. Raymond Felton is at 13.1 ppg, G Brevin Knight 12.4 ppg, 7.2 asts, and F Sean May is at 11.7 pts, 6.8 rebs. May is another guy the Magic bypassed in last year's draft in order to draft Fran Vasquez. CHA is averaging just 91 ppg while allowing 99 ppg. The Magic average 93.4 ppg, while allowing 92.8 ppg.

DHoward has always played well against CHA . He has 2 career 20/20 games against them. Magic have lost 3 out of the last 4 games in CHA.
